Join us as we shape the future of AI and beyond.  Together, we advance your career.  THE ROLE: We are building an AI-native hardware and firmware validation platform from the ground up — one where LLMs, RAG pipelines, autonomous agents, and knowledge graphs are the core of how the system works, not an add-on. As the Software Development Architect, you will own the end-to-end technical design of this platform: multi-agent orchestration, retrieval-augmented knowledge systems, MCP server infrastructure, and the engineering standards that make all of it reliable at scale. This role sits within the Global Cluster Engineering organization, where you will develop software that powers distributed infrastructure at global scale. You will work closely with validation engineers, hardware teams, and leadership to translate domain requirements into a production-grade AI-native system. This is a hands-on role — you will write code, drive technology decisions, and directly mentor engineers.THE PERSON: Experience:  software development experience, with at least 4 years in architecture, staff, or principal engineer roleAI-Native Systems: Deep, hands-on experience designing and shipping production AI-native systems — not just LLM API integration, but the full stack: RAG pipelines, agent orchestration, tool use, multi-agent coordination, and LLM evaluationLLM Fundamentals: Strong understanding of how LLMs work in practice — context windows, grounding, hallucination failure modes, prompt engineering, model selection, and how behavior changes across providers and versionsRetrieval Systems: Proven experience with vector search, embedding models, hybrid retrieval, reranking pipelines, and knowledge graph-augmented RAGCore Skills: Strong proficiency in one or more modern programming languages such as Python, TypeScript/Node.js, Go, Java, C#, or Rust, with demonstrated ability to build and operate production-scale services. Python experience is preferred due to the AI/ML ecosystemEngineering excellence: Async programming, API design, distributed systems, clean code practices. Experience designing for reliability in automated/unattended environments — crash recovery, audit trails, state management, observability. Strong written communication — architecture docs, design specs, and engineering standards that outlast your tenure.
